Abstract
The phenomenon of Fear of Missing Out (FOMO) refers to feelings of anxiety or fear of being left out, which are often experienced by adolescents due to the urge to stay connected with social activities, especially through social media such as TikTok and Instagram. This condition affects how students perceive and evaluate themselves, known as self image. This study aims to explore the impact of FOMO on the formation of students’ self-image. This research employs a qualitative method with a phenomenological approach. The subjects are students of SMP Negeri 2 Balerejo who are active social media users and show symptoms of FOMO. Data were collected through in-depth interviews and observations, and analyzed using data reduction, data presentation, and conclusion drawing techniques. The findings reveal that students’ self image is shaped by a combination of personal perceptions and social responses, particularly those obtained through social media. FOMO arises from the intensity of social media use, peer pressure, and emotional needs for social acceptance. It has a negative impact on the formation of self image, as students tend to shape their self-concept based on trends and external validation rather than authentic self-understanding. These findings contribute to guidance and counseling services, particularly in developing preventive programs against FOMO tendencies. School counselors can use these results as a reference in designing individual and group counseling strategies to help students build a positive and healthy self-image amid digital social pressures
